I have this unit working, I was getting a lot of failures, and it would drop off line after a short
time of operation, I observed a note from another member that the frame rate of ZM and the
camera should be the same, I went it and set the camera to the same as the max frame
on my ZM system, that appears to have helped the off line issue.
I also have been trying to use the RSTP function. If I use VLC, I go in and select <network
device>, I then select RSTP, enter the address and the port (554) and get a stream. When I
try to set up ZM, I get no video. Any idea of what I am doing wrong, I do not see any additional path to the RTSP source. VLC shows good video, but ZM just does not see it.
Any ideas of what is going on?

A follow up on the on going problem with the abs megacam. Here are some of the error
messages ZM tosses while communicating with this cam.
The number of extraneous bytes will vary from a low of 20+ bytes to 75 bytes (that is
the largest number I have seen) most are around 40 to 50 bytes.
messages ZM tosses while communicating with this cam.
Code: Select all
zmc_m4[8710]: WAR [Corrupt JPEG data: 41 extraneous bytes before marker 0xd9]
zmc_m4[8710]: WAR [Corrupt JPEG data: premature end of data segment]
zmc_m4[8710]: WAR [Corrupt JPEG data: bad Huffman code]
